Openvpn что это такое
OpenVPN что это такое
OpenVPN — это одно из самых популярных решений для создания виртуальных частных сетей (VPN), которое обеспечивает безопасное и защищенное соединение через интернет. Используемая в OpenVPN технология позволяет создавать зашифрованные каналы для обмена данными, обеспечивая высокую степень конфиденциальности и безопасности при передаче информации между пользователями и удаленными ресурсами.
Принципы работы OpenVPN
OpenVPN использует технологии виртуальных частных сетей для создания защищенных туннелей через интернет. Важной характеристикой является то, что OpenVPN поддерживает несколько типов шифрования и протоколов для аутентификации пользователей и защиты данных.
-
Шифрование данных: OpenVPN использует сильные алгоритмы шифрования, такие как AES (Advanced Encryption Standard), для защиты передаваемой информации. Это обеспечивает высокий уровень безопасности, что делает OpenVPN подходящим для использования как в личных, так и в корпоративных сетях.
-
Аутентификация пользователей: С помощью сертификатов, ключей и паролей OpenVPN аутентифицирует пользователей, обеспечивая возможность безопасного подключения к сети. Для улучшения защиты возможно использование двухфакторной аутентификации.
-
Механизмы туннелирования: OpenVPN позволяет создавать туннели различных типов — от защищенных TCP- и UDP-соединений до виртуальных частных сетей с использованием IPsec и других технологий. Это делает OpenVPN гибким решением для разных сценариев использования.
Основные преимущества OpenVPN
OpenVPN обладает рядом важных преимуществ, которые делают его одним из самых популярных решений для создания VPN-сетей:
-
Гибкость конфигурации: OpenVPN поддерживает различные протоколы, включая TCP и UDP, что позволяет выбрать оптимальный способ передачи данных в зависимости от конкретных требований.
-
Высокая безопасность: Использование современных алгоритмов шифрования и аутентификации обеспечивает надежную защиту данных.
-
Поддержка различных операционных систем: OpenVPN совместим с большинством операционных систем, включая Windows, macOS, Linux, а также мобильные платформы, такие как Android и iOS.
-
Открытый исходный код: Поскольку OpenVPN является проектом с открытым исходным кодом, его можно бесплатно использовать, а также модифицировать и адаптировать под специфические нужды.
Как настроить OpenVPN
Настройка OpenVPN требует выполнения нескольких шагов, которые могут отличаться в зависимости от типа сети и устройства. Однако общий процесс настройки включает:
1. Установка OpenVPN
Для начала необходимо установить OpenVPN на сервере и клиентских устройствах. Для серверной части процесс установки обычно включает установку программного обеспечения на сервере, а для клиентов — на устройствах пользователей.
2. Генерация ключей и сертификатов
Для обеспечения безопасного соединения необходимо сгенерировать ключи и сертификаты. Это можно сделать с помощью утилиты EasyRSA, которая упрощает процесс создания этих файлов.
3. Настройка конфигурационных файлов
OpenVPN использует конфигурационные файлы, в которых указываются параметры соединения, такие как IP-адреса серверов, используемые протоколы, порты и алгоритмы шифрования.
4. Настройка брандмауэра и маршрутизации
Для того чтобы обеспечить правильную маршрутизацию трафика через OpenVPN, необходимо настроить брандмауэры и маршруты на сервере. Это поможет направлять трафик на сервер OpenVPN и обеспечить корректную работу сети.
5. Подключение клиентов
После настройки серверной части нужно настроить клиенты для подключения к сети через OpenVPN. Для этого необходимо передать клиентам соответствующие сертификаты и ключи.
Безопасность OpenVPN
OpenVPN отличается высокой степенью безопасности, благодаря использованию современных алгоритмов шифрования и аутентификации. Однако для обеспечения максимальной безопасности важно правильно настроить VPN-сервер и соблюсти рекомендации по защите данных.
К примеру, использование RSA-ключей для аутентификации и алгоритма AES для шифрования позволяет защитить передаваемую информацию от большинства современных угроз. Кроме того, важно следить за актуальностью версий программного обеспечения и регулярно обновлять OpenVPN, чтобы предотвратить возможные уязвимости.
Применение OpenVPN
OpenVPN используется в самых разных сценариях, начиная от личного использования и заканчивая корпоративными решениями.
Личное использование
Для обычных пользователей OpenVPN может быть полезен для защиты личных данных при использовании общественных Wi-Fi сетей или для обхода географических блокировок. OpenVPN позволяет создать защищенное соединение с интернетом, обеспечивая конфиденциальность и безопасность в процессе серфинга.
Корпоративное использование
В корпоративной среде OpenVPN используется для создания защищенных соединений между офисами, удаленными сотрудниками и ресурсами компании. Это позволяет обеспечить безопасный доступ к внутренним данным и сервисам, сократить риски утечек данных и повысить уровень безопасности всей корпоративной сети.
Возможности OpenVPN
Поддержка мобильных устройств
OpenVPN предоставляет решение для мобильных устройств, что позволяет пользователям подключаться к VPN-сетям с телефонов и планшетов. Это особенно важно для сотрудников, работающих удаленно, так как OpenVPN гарантирует безопасность подключения даже при использовании нестабильных мобильных сетей.
Множество клиентов
OpenVPN поддерживает работу с различными клиентами и может быть настроен для работы в сетях, где используются различные операционные системы, такие как Windows, Linux, macOS и другие. Это делает OpenVPN универсальным инструментом для создания защищенных VPN-сетей.
FAQ
Как настроить OpenVPN на сервере?
Для настройки OpenVPN на сервере необходимо установить соответствующее программное обеспечение, создать и настроить ключи и сертификаты, а затем настроить конфигурационные файлы и маршрутизацию трафика.
Что такое OpenVPN сервер?
OpenVPN сервер — это сервер, на котором установлен OpenVPN, предназначенный для обеспечения защищенного соединения между пользователями и сетью. Он использует зашифрованные туннели для передачи данных.
Можно ли использовать OpenVPN бесплатно?
Да, OpenVPN является бесплатным программным обеспечением с открытым исходным кодом, что позволяет использовать его без каких-либо затрат.
Как обеспечить безопасность при использовании OpenVPN?
Для обеспечения безопасности необходимо правильно настроить сервер, использовать надежные алгоритмы шифрования и аутентификации, а также следить за актуальностью программного обеспечения.
Какие альтернативы OpenVPN существуют?
Существуют различные альтернативы OpenVPN, такие как L2TP, IPsec, WireGuard и другие. Однако OpenVPN продолжает оставаться одним из самых безопасных и универсальных решений для создания VPN-сетей.
Комментариев 0